The historic, riverside Command House has recently undergone a half a million-pound renovation.

Built in the 1800s, the Grade II listed new-look hostelry steeped in military history, has period features and a panoramic view over the river towards the former Chatham Dockyard and the ongoing regeneration town centre project.

The building, in Dock Road, boasts features including brick-vaulted ceilings in the basement bar, recessed windows and period tile and flagstone floors. There are seating options at every turn, from quiet, secluded nooks to family tables.

Hosting an extensive food and drink menu - there should be something to suit everyone’s taste. Offers include Afternoon Tea, Sunday Roasts with all the trimmings (including free refills on roast potatoes, Yorkshire puddings and gravy) plus a set menu and lunch and a drink offer throughout the week.
